Which Linux Distro for building Preboot Authentication (PBA).
 
Hi all

I am trying to decide on which Linux distribution to use for Pre boot authentication software (Intel, AMD processors). This project is from scratch (I understand some might say use existing PBA solutions; answer is, can't :))

My requirements
PBA with minimal GUI; STABLE distro; minimal OS size; support for USB, mouse, key board and PC card to access internet; Intel, AMD processors.

Questions
1. Which Distro the experts recommend?
2. Would appreciate any other pointers from experienced PBA developers.

Thank you and appreciate your help.

For a minimal distro you could look for Slitaz 3.0
It has a GUI and an up-to-date kernel. The download is only 30 MB and you can ad missing apps for your purpose quite easy.
